China Silver Group Suffers Interim Loss on Revenue Slump
China Silver Group Limited reported an interim loss for the six months to June 30, 2026. The company's revenue plummeted by 75.7% year-on-year to RMB508.7 million, resulting in a net loss of RMB24.1 million attributable to shareholders.
This represents a sharp reversal from the previous interim profit of RMB54.9 million. Management attributed the decline primarily to weaker demand for silver ingots due to higher silver prices and substantial share-based payment expenses.
However, the manufacturing segment showed some resilience, with gross profit and margin improving significantly due to sales of low-cost silver inventories.
